A method for determining relative year class strength (YCS) in unexploited freshwater fish populations from individual surveys, based on reconstruction of the mortality schedule of the target population, is described. The method was tested against traditional approaches of assessment of YCS and the limitations and applicability discussed. The method is useful for analysing the factors regulating YCS in freshwater fisheries.  相似文献

Stocking and electrofishing occurrence and abundance data for northern pike Esox lucius L. in >3800 km of French rivers across 7 years were compared to assess the effect of recreational fisheries stocking programmes on wild pike populations. A positive relationship was found between the additive effect of stocking and the size of the stocked pike. However, the stocking programmes implemented in France by recreational fishery managers from 2008 to 2013 increased the probability of pike occurring in the river network, without increasing abundance in well-established pike populations, because pike stocked in their early-life stages were used in most of the stocking programmes.  相似文献

Assessing the value of recreational sea angling in South West England   总被引:1,自引:0,他引:1  
Abstract  A choice experiment was developed to assess how the value of the recreational sea angling experience in South West England would change as characteristics of the angling experience changed. Catch levels of anglers' favourite species are extremely important, until they reach around six fish per day, at which point anglers become satiated. Anglers are discerning about the species they catch – they would pay only a third as much for increased catches of non-favourite species than for the favourite species. Overall, increasing the size of individual fish would have a larger impact than increasing the catch per day, although this varies by species. In contrast, the presence or absence of rod or bag limits and the environmental quality of a site are only minor factors in anglers' decisions on where to fish. These results will help fisheries managers to identify their goals with respect to sea angling.  相似文献

This study aimed to assess the suitability of the Berkowitz' ( 2005 ) social norms approach (SNA) for improving compliance behaviour amongst recreational fishers. A total of 138 recreational shore anglers were interviewed in Eastern Cape, South Africa and asked about their compliance, attitudes towards compliance, perceptions of compliance and the attitudes of other anglers. Results indicate that angler compliance for individual regulations was relatively high (75%–90%). Attitudes of anglers towards compliance was positive, with >80% feeling that “breaking any regulation is wrong.” Yet, as predicted by the SNA, interviewees often overestimated the non‐compliance and negative attitudes of other anglers, particularly as their social proximity decreased. Interviewees with the greatest misperceptions were also less compliant. The social norms present in the Eastern Cape rock and surf fishery fulfil the criteria required for the application of the SNA, suggesting that this approach may provide a suitable normative intervention for improving compliance to be used in conjunction with instrumental approaches in recreational fisheries.  相似文献

Abstract  Recreational shore angling in the Atlantic Ocean between Moledo and Aveiro (Portugal) was examined using roving creel surveys (March/September 2001). Cooperation was high (90% of 2310 anglers approached). At least 39 species of fish were caught at a rate of approximately 0.5 fish angler h−1. An estimated 7319 kg of Dicentrarchus labrax (L.), with 45.6% below the minimum legal size, and 2040 kg of sea breams (genus Diplodus ), correspond to 5.75% and 1.19% of the commercial landings in the same geographical area, respectively. The results shed light on a number of issues relevant to integrated coastal management, including temporal and spatial distribution of fishing effort, species caught, sizes of fish, catch rates, and factors influencing catches and angler satisfaction. Whilst the results suggest that the catches of sea breams and sea bass by day-time recreational shore angling in northern Portugal are small compared with commercial fishing, other recreational activities, such as boat fishing and spear-fishing, must be assessed.  相似文献

Abstract  Catch-and-release angling is a well-established practice in recreational angler behaviour and fisheries management. Accompanying this is a growing body of catch-and-release research that can be applied to reduce injury, mortality and sublethal alterations in behaviour and physiology. Here, the status of catch-and-release research from a symposium on the topic is summarised. Several general themes emerged including the need to: (1) better connect sublethal assessments to population-level processes; (2) enhance understanding of the variation in fish, fishing practices and gear and their role in catch and release; (3) better understand animal welfare issues related to catch and release; (4) increase the exchange of information on fishing-induced stress, injury and mortality between the recreational and commercial fishing sectors; and (5) improve procedures for measuring and understanding the effect of catch-and-release angling. Through design of better catch-and-release studies, strategies could be developed to further minimise stress, injury and mortality arising from catch-and-release angling. These strategies, when integrated with other fish population and fishery characteristics, can be used by anglers and managers to sustain or enhance recreational fishing resources.  相似文献

The role of recreational fisheries in the competition for marine resources is increasingly recognised. Their contribution in stock dynamics needs to be accounted for in assessments and management. Management regulations should be based on scientific advice on human and biological dimensions to be effective in reaching their goals. A survey among marine angling tourists staying in fishing camps in two study areas in Norway was conducted to study catch‐and‐release (C&R) behaviour. Although C&R has been assumed to be low in many marine recreational fisheries, this survey showed that for some species, more than 60% of the catch was released. As C&R may be associated with post‐release mortalities, the current management system could be inefficient towards its aim of reducing fishing mortality. It was concluded that it is necessary to quantify release mortalities, to consider C&R behaviour in future management decisions, and to minimise the potential negative impacts of C&R through handling guidelines.  相似文献

Abstract  Because of low fishing mortality that results from catch-and-release angling for carp, Cyprinius carpio L, it is counterintuitive that voluntary catch-and-release (vC&R) of this species induces conflicts within the angling community. Originally motivated by animal welfare concerns, vC&R is today probably as or more strongly criticised within the angling community itself than it is intersectorally. This study reviews the institutional treatment of C&R in Germany and explores within a sociological conflict model the conflicting views surrounding vC&R, specifically in specialised carp angling. It is argued that the intrasectoral (i.e. among angler groups) conflicts around vC&R fishing may divide the recreational angling community, which in turn may weaken the coherence of the entire angling sector. Restricting the opportunity to practice vC&R also can have important social and biological implications, which suggest a rethinking on the current treatment of vC&R recreational angling in Germany.  相似文献

The debate over Atlantic salmon, Salmo salar L., stocking in Britain centres on the trade‐off between enhancing rod fisheries and harming wild populations. This article informs the debate by quantifying the relationship between stocking and angler catch statistics for 62 rivers over 15 years. After controlling for environmental factors affecting adult abundance, the 42 rivers with stocking had non‐significantly lower mean catch statistics than the 20 rivers without stocking. This difference increased with the age of stocked fish. Among stocked rivers, weak relationships between mean stocking effort and catch statistics also became more negative with the age of stocked fish. For stocked rivers, there was no evidence for a generally positive relationship between annual stocking efforts and catch statistics. Those rivers for which stocking appeared to improve annual rod catches tended to have lower than expected mean rod catches. The results suggest the damage inflicted on wild salmon populations by stocking is not balanced by detectable benefits to rod fisheries.  相似文献

Abstract Inland fisheries in England and Wales have high economic and social values. Managing participation to maximise fishery performance is key to maintaining this status. The capital value of fishing rights for migratory salmonid fisheries is €165 million. Coarse fisheries contribute €1030 million to the economy. The central tenet to increasing participation in recreational salmonid fisheries is that an increase in stock size will result in more anglers accessing the fishery. This was examined for salmon on the rivers Usk and Lune where exploitation restrictions increased the number of salmon available to anglers. On the River Lune, the number of salmon available post‐intervention increased by 66%. There was no significant increase in catch while the number of anglers decreased by 16.3%. On the River Usk, the closure of the net fishery potentially resulted in an additional ~1200 salmon being available. Following closure, there was no significant change in rod catch or in the number of anglers. Increased participation is dependent less upon stock manipulation for coarse fisheries and more upon facilitating the activity. In recent years, urban fishery development programmes have provided improved access to local fishing opportunity. Also, new anglers have been targeted through campaigns such as Get Hooked on Fishing and the Scout Angler Badge.  相似文献

Abstract  In England and Wales, freshwater anglers have shifted their behaviour towards visiting catch-and-release lake fisheries that are intensively stocked, mainly of large common carp, Cyprinus carpio L., to maintain high catch rates. Of 187 fish kills investigated in these intensively stocked lake fisheries in 2004 and 2005, most occurred between April and June and were mainly caused by parasitic or bacterial infections. Bacteria were usually associated with ulcerative diseases caused by strains of the bacterium Aeromonas salmonicida (Emmerich & Weibel) and secondary infections of opportunistic bacteria of the Genus Aeromonas (excluding salmonicida ) and Pseudomonas . Parasites involved in fish kills included Ichthyophthirius multifiliis (Fouquet), Chilodenella sp., Ichthyobodo necator (Henneguy) and Argulus sp. Outbreaks were typically in fisheries with high extant stock densities (>1500 kg ha−1) and sub-optimal habitats, for example of low habitat heterogeneity with few macrophytes in the littoral zone. Recent stocking was also a key factor when only carp was affected. Thus, certain fisheries management practices that aim to enhance fishery performance may instead trigger fish kills during spring.  相似文献

It is well known that fish can learn to avoid angling gear after experiencing a catch‐and‐release event, that is, after a private hooking experience. However, the possible importance of social information cues and their influence on an individual's vulnerability to angling remains largely unexplored, that is, social experience of a conspecific capture. The effects of private and social experience of hooking on the stress response of fish and subsequent catch rates were examined. Hatchery‐reared rainbow trout, Oncorhynchus mykiss (Walbaum), were implanted with heart rate loggers and experimentally subjected to private or social experience of hooking. Private and social experience of angling induced an increased heart rate in fish compared with naïve control fish. While private experience of hooking explained most of the reduced vulnerability to capture, no clear evidence was found that social experience of hooking affected angling vulnerability in fish that had never been hooked before. While both private and social experiences of angling constitute significant physiological stressors for rainbow trout, only the private experience reduces an individual's vulnerability to angling and in turn affecting population‐level catchability.  相似文献

In northern industrialized countries, the inland fisheries sector has long been dominated by recreational fisheries, which normally exploit fish for leisure or subsistence and provide many (poorly investigated) benefits to society. Various factors constrain the development and existence of inland fisheries, such as local user conflicts, low social priority and inadequate research and funding. In many cases, however, degradation of the environment and loss of aquatic habitat are the predominant concerns for the sustainability of inland fisheries. The need for concerted effort to prevent and reduce environmental degradation, as well as conservation of freshwater fish and fisheries as renewable common pool resources or entities in their own right is the greatest challenge facing sustainable development of inland waters. In inland fisheries management, the declining quality of the aquatic environment coupled with long‐term inadequate and often inappropriate fisheries management has led to an emphasis on enhancement practices, such as stocking, to mitigate anthropogenic stress. However, this is not always the most appropriate management approach. Therefore, there is an urgent need to alter many traditional inland fisheries management practices and systems to focus on sustainable development. This paper reviews the literature regarding the inputs needed for sustainability of inland fisheries in industrialized countries. To understand better the problems facing sustainable inland fisheries management, the inland fisheries environment, its benefits, negative impacts and constraints, as well as historical management, paradigms, trends and current practices are described. Major philosophical shifts, challenges and promising integrated management approaches are envisaged in a holistic framework. The following are considered key elements for sustainable development of inland fisheries: communication, information dissemination, education, institutional restructuring, marketing outreach, management plans, decision analysis, socioeconomic evaluation and research into the human dimension, in addition to traditional biological and ecological sciences. If these inputs are integrated with traditional fisheries management practices, the prospects for sustainability in the inland fisheries will be enhanced.  相似文献

Recreational fishing is a commonplace leisure activity within the developed world but can generate tension when activities conflict with conservation agendas. A potential conflict arises over the use of European river lamprey, Lampetra fluviatilis (L.), a protected species, by UK coarse (freshwater non-salmonid) predator anglers. This study used geographically stratified interviews with 69 predator anglers to explore attitudes towards the use of lamprey as bait, their conservation status and knowledge of biosecurity regulations. Most participants used lamprey as bait to some degree and agreed that, if threatened by exploitation, a ban on their use as angling bait should be implemented. Ordinal regression analysis indicated the presence of a subset of anglers who value lamprey as bait more than others and may oppose conservation efforts. The benefits of the potential establishment of bait certification schemes are also considered.  相似文献

The welfare of fish is a topic of increasing debate touching on a number of complex scientific and ethical issues and constructive dialogue between groups with differing approaches to the topic requires mutual understanding from both perspectives. In a recent review aimed at stimulating debate on this topic, Arlinghaus et al. (2007) explore the question of fish welfare in the particular context of recreational angling, by means of a critique of a review of fish welfare in general written by ourselves ( Huntingford et al. 2006 ). We entirely agree with the desirability of debate on this topic and recognize a number of valuable qualities in the commentary by Arlinghaus et al. However, we argue that the critique has some serious flaws. In the first place, by rejecting a feelings‐based approach to welfare, it fails to address the aspect of welfare that is at the heart of much legitimate public concern. Secondly, while advocating an objective, scientific approach to fish welfare, Arlinghaus et al. fail to present their own agenda (that recreational angling is morally acceptable) in a transparent way. Thirdly, they seriously misrepresent the position taken in Huntingford et al. (2006) on a number of important issues. In this reply, we address these points and then discuss briefly the areas of agreement and constructive disagreement between the two reviews.  相似文献

Abstract Atlantic salmon, Salmo salar L., recreational fisheries in Norway are facing shorter seasons and harvest restrictions because of low adult migration runs. Private fishing‐right holders (landowners) are important stakeholders, being co‐managers of the stocks, owners of salmon habitat and suppliers of angling. Landowners saw measures addressing salmon farming and Gyrodactylus salaris (Malmberg) as the most important management actions to strengthen stocks and downplayed actions restricting their own activity or gain. The results showed a need to build knowledge and improve communication between landowners and river owner organisations about the effects of stocking, catch and release, and other management actions. Four distinct landowner types were identified, based on their objectives for the fishing right. The diversity in the landowner group suggests managing angling tourism will be challenging, and cooperation is required to manage salmon stocks. Policy instruments to facilitate cooperation are discussed for each landowner type.  相似文献

Over the past 20 years, there has been a dramatic increase in the use of physiological tools and experimental approaches for the study of the biological consequences of catch‐and‐release angling practices for fishes. Beyond simply documenting problems, physiological data are also being used to test and refine different strategies for handling fish such that stress is minimised and survival probability maximised, and in some cases, even for assessing and facilitating recovery post‐release. The inherent sensitivity of physiological processes means that nearly every study conducted has found some level of – unavoidable – physiological disturbance arising from recreational capture and subsequent release. An underlying tenet of catch‐and‐release studies that incorporate physiological tools is that a link exists between physiological status and fitness. In reality, finding such relationships has been elusive, with further extensions of individual‐level impacts to fish populations even more dubious. A focus of this article is to describe some of the challenges related to experimental design and interpretation that arise when using physiological tools for the study of the biological consequences of catch‐and‐release angling. Means of overcoming these challenges and the extrapolation of physiological data from individuals to the population level are discussed. The argument is presented that even if it is difficult to demonstrate strong links to mortality or other fitness measures, let alone population‐level impacts of catch‐and‐release, there remains merit in using physiological tools as objective indicators of fish welfare, which is an increasing concern in recreational fisheries. The overarching objective of this paper is to provide a balanced critique of the use of physiological approaches in catch‐and‐release science and of their role in providing meaningful information for anglers and managers.  相似文献
